The NRG-FRP-301 is a large, fixed-back bucket racing seat crafted from high-quality fiberglass reinforced material. It features deep thigh bolsters, shoulder and lumbar support, and is compatible with 4-point harnesses. Weighing only 15-18 lbs, it offers a universal fit with durable injection-molded foam and woven upholstery, making it ideal for both real racing and sim rig setups.

Overall good seat, with only a few minor flaws
Overall, this is a nice seat. I do think it is a little bit expensive for what you get. Pros: (a) It is beautiful. It brings the visual appearance of my sim rig up a huge notch from the standard computer chair that was on it before. (b) The seat cushion material is nice. I think the fabric does a good job at minimizing the heat of sitting in a chair for extended use -- I don't really get hot or uncomfortable after sitting in this chair for a long time. (c) Fit: this thing fits me like I'd want my racecar seat to fit me - it funtions well for its intended purpose. I'm 5'9 and 150 lbs. At the same time, its big enough that some of my bigger friends can comfortable hop in my sim rig and run some laps without feeling like their hips are getting crushed in. Cons: (a) If you are someone who prefers your seat with a significant degree layback, this isn't really the best option. For one, the back is not adjustable. And two, if you mount the seat with the bolts through the top mount of your bracket in the front, and the lowest hole on your bracket in the back, you are going to have a hard time mounting this seat. The bottom of the seat will hit your bracket before you can get the bolt into the mounting hole. The rear mounting hole just needs to be lower in the seat design. (b) The lumbar support is lacking. If you sit in this thing for a couple of hours, you may feel like your lower back hurts. Mine sometimes does after extended use.
